BHOPAL: The eighth convocation of National Institute of Fashion Technology (NIFT), Bhopal was held at a private hotel in the city on Saturday. The institute also celebrated a decade of its journey in the city of lakes on the occasion. 87 students received their degrees in various courses at the convocation ceremony.
Chief electoral officer of Madhya Pradesh V L Kantha Rao was the chief guest.
He threw light on the importance of innovation in technology and advised the new graduates to work with small town weavers. He also threw light on the 19 innovation hubs of MP.
"When you have the experience of working with weavers who use traditional designs, you will learn a lot from them but at the same time you also have to teach them about new and innovative technology and designs that you have learnt here at NIFT. The two things go hand in hand. Many people know how to use technology, but do not have the innovation streak. We have to keep experimenting and learning new things to stand out of the crowd," he said.
Dressed in a saris and kurta-pajama, the students reaped the fruit of their hard-work on the occasion. They also exhibited the collection of cushion covers, ethnic and Western outfits, and jewellery designed by them as part of their internship projects with different firms.
Abhishek Raj bagged the title of 'Student of the year' while Sanskar Jain was felicitated with the 'Extraordinary Service Award'. "It has been a remarkable experience. We have presented 20 awards to students whose designs have stood out. I wish them the best and hope they will make us proud," said Sameer Sood, joint director, NIFT Bhopal.
Sunil Kumar, vice-chancellor, RGPV and Abhay Shukla, chief executive Officer, M/s Trident Limited were present as guests of honour.
